NSS Product Code: N/A
My first post:
I installed NSS, ran it, pressed "scan for new devices", then went to "phone info" and hit "scan".
I got Phone version, IMEI and the rest of the first 5 lines of info correctly, but "product code" along with all the rest of the fields on the list (warranty start and end, etc.) have a value of "n/a".
Does anybody have a clue what this means? Am I safe to change the product code and go ahead with reinstalling the firmware?
General info:
N95 8GB, RM-320. Came with firmware v15 and I upgraded the firmware to v20 without changing the product code...yes, I MUST debrand!
BTW, NSU tells me I CAN re-install the firmware, so my plan was to change the product code, reinstall and hope it's debranded. Any fault in my logic?

Ohhh.. you mean THAT "read" button... I was looking at the grayed out "read" button below the "Scan" button...thanks!
And just to sneak in a second question in there: If I change the product code and REINSTALL the same firmware I already have...should that debrand my phone?

Yes, reinstall the same firmware, and it will debrand it, providing you change the product code to a debranded one.
